The Role of Expert Witnesses in Daycare Abuse Cases
In Georgia, daycare abuse cases often turn on complex factual scenarios and intricate legal questions. Here, expert witnesses play a pivotal role in providing clarity and specialized knowledge to the court. These individuals, who possess extensive experience or advanced education in relevant fields like pediatrics, psychology, or early childhood development, can offer insights that are beyond the typical understanding of laypersons.
Their testimony helps explain the signs and symptoms of abuse, the developmental stages of children, and the potential long-term effects of trauma. Expert witnesses can also critique the handling of evidence, witness statements, and the overall investigation process. This expertise is invaluable for a daycare abuse lawyer in Georgia, as it strengthens the case, refutes opposing arguments, and ultimately seeks justice for the victims.
